Web23 aug. 2024 · Free inspections. This scammer “just happened to be working in the neighborhood” and noticed some damage. The scammer offers to go up on the roof and inspect it for free. After the inspection the conclusion is, of course, that the roof has substantial damage and needs to be fixed right away. WebHow to Inspect Your Roof CertainTeed Home how to inspect roof How to Inspect Your Roof WHAT TO LOOK FOR AND WHEN TO CALL A PROFESSIONAL Too many of us take our roofs for granted -- it’s not … Web23 dec. 2024 · Nationally, the price for a roof inspection ranges from $100 to $600. On the low end, an exterior inspection of a 1,000 sq.ft. flat roof costs $75. On the high end, thermal imaging with an infrared drone of a 3,000 sq.ft. sloped roof costs $750.
